1st Source Bank Visa College Real Rewards is a no-annual-fee points card from 1st Source Bank. It earns 1.5x on every purchase with no categories to track. Rewards are Elan Rewards points that only spend inside that program, so we value them at about 0.67¢ each.
On our reference budget of $24,600 a year it returns about $246, an effective 1% back. The welcome bonus, 2,500 points, adds to the first year's return.
It is a stepping-stone card. Keep the balance low and revisit once your score reaches the good range, where no-fee cards with better rates open up. It charges 3% on foreign purchases, so leave it home when you travel abroad.

Reference budget: groceries $6,000, dining and restaurants $3,600, gas and ev charging $2,400, travel and transit $3,000, online shopping $2,400, entertainment and streaming $1,200, everything else $6,000. Points are valued at 1¢ unless the program is worth less; statement credits, welcome bonuses, and perks are left out. Run it with your own spending.
